Qualified Person and Quality Assurance and Quality Control

The disclosure of scientific and technical information contained in this presentation has been approved by Alger St-Jean, P.Geo, Vice President, Exploration of Orford, a Qualified Person under NI

43-101.

Samples reported in this presentation and indicated as grab, outcrop, sub-outcrop, boulders and float are grab samples. Grab samples are selective by nature and values reported may not be

representative of mineralized zones. All drill intervals reported in this presentation are down-hole core lengths as true thicknesses cannot be determined with available information.

The work program at Qiqavik was supervised by Alger St-Jean, P.Geo, VP Exploration who is responsible for all aspects of the work, including the quality control/quality assurance program. On-site

personnel at the project log and weigh all samples prior to sealing and shipping. Sample shipments are sealed and shipped to Techni-Lab, Sainte-Germaine-Boulé, Québec. All gold assays

reported were obtained by either 350-g screen fire assay or standard 50-gram fire-assaying-AA finish or gravimetric finish (method 1A2-5 and 1A3-50) at. The 350-g screen assay method is

selected by the site geologist or the lab when samples contain coarse gold or higher percentage of sulfide mineralization that may be associated with gold relative to surrounding intervals. All

samples are also analyzed for multi-elements, including copper and silver, using a four-acid method with an ICP-EOS and ICP-MS finish at Techi-labs affiliated Actlabs in Ancaster, Ontario.

Overlimits were analyzed by peroxide fusion with ICP-EOS finish. Drill program design, Quality Assurance/Quality Control (“QA/QC”) and interpretation of results is performed by qualified persons

employing a QA/QC program consistent with NI 43-101 and industry best practices. Standards and blanks are inserted at a minimum of 10% and 5% for core and grab samples respectively for

QA/QC purposes in addition to those inserted by the lab. A subset of samples has not yet been sent for a verification assay at another lab.

Techni-Lab Laboratory, is a subsidiary of Act Labs, is accredited (n. 707) by the Standards Council of Canada and found to comply with the requirements of ISO/IEC 17025:2005 (CAN-P-4E) and

CAN-P-1579.

40-km long Qiqavik Break Shear Zone remains largely unexplored with potential for multiple large gold deposits

1. This information is not necessarily indicative of the mineralization on Orford Mining’s properties

• 100% interest in ~348 km2 of highly prospective

gold properties in northern Quebec

• ~60 km from Glencore’s world-class Raglan Mine

• The parallel ultramafic “Raglan Belt” has yielded

world-class nickel deposits, but the northern

volcano-sedimentary portion of the Belt remains

virtually unexplored

• Property covers the 40 km long Qiqavik Break

Shear Zone and part of the Cape Smith Belt

• Gold districts with similar tectonic and age setting

to the Cape Smith Belt include1:

➢ Flin Flon/Snow Lake, Canada

➢ Ashanti Belt, West Africa

➢ Tanami Goldfields, West Australia

➢ Tapajos-Parima Belt, Brazil

• 11 significant mineralized areas discovered

➢ Includes Interlake, Esperance, Esperance West, Horizon,

Aurora, Aurora West, Gerfaut, Gerfaut South, ABG Zone,

Focused Intrusive and Central Qiqavik

Eastern Property Historic Work

1995 -1998 Falconbridge – SOQUEM

• FL drilled two holes into an EM anomaly and SOQUEM later resampled in DDH PAR96-01 extended mineralized zone to 10.5m of 3.08g/t Au which includes

1.1m of 5.45 g/t Au, 0.59%Zn and 3.4m of 6.79 g/t Au and 0.37% Zn

2011-2012 Tectonic Resources – Corvus Gold

• Geochem surveys across the eastern section of Qiqavik

• Intersected gold mineralization in all holes drilled in 2019 targeting three different geological structures on the property separated by up to 18km.

• Extended the thick gold mineralized trend in drilling to 2.5km of the 5km structural package along the Interlake Shear Structure (Up to 53m @0.51 in 19-QK-004))

• Confirmed gold mineralization in drilling results associated with multiple quartz veins in the felsic intrusive body, The Focused Intrusion, (QK-19-06, 1.84mtres @2.8 g/t including 0.58metres @ 8.57 g/t).

• Confirmed gold in drilling (Qk-19-002) on the 7 km long IP Lake Shear (10 metres @ 0.58 g/t)

• Defined multiple gold mineralization boulder trains associated untested cross structures along the newly discovered, 7-km long IP lake shear corridor potentially derived from untested cross structures along the IP Lake Shear.

• Reported high grade gold on a newly discovered contact-shear trend south of Esperance (Up to 20.62g/t Au)

• Results still Pending: Glacial Till Sample Gold Grain Counts primarily from new IP LAKE Shear Coridor

Orford MiningLocal Community Involvement

• Orford maintains an open dialog with local communities

• Representatives of Salluit, Akulivik and Kativik Regional Gov. (KRG) have visited the site

• Working with Landholding Corporations to hire local workforce during summer exploration programs

• Inuit hiring and training in each exploration program.

• 2019, 11% of exploration expenditures were with Nunavik Inuit Enterprises

• Identifying and notifying communities and Avataq of archeological sites

• Provided in-kind support to KRG for abandoned mineral exploration site rehabilitation

Fostering strong relationships with government, local communities and First Nations Groups

West Raglan ProjectLarge Land Package in a Rich Nickel, PGE District

Massive 470 km2 property in a prolific, yet underexplored region in Quebec

• 100%-owned, advanced stage Ni-Cu-PGE

exploration project covering nearly 470 km2 in

the Cape Smith Belt, Nunavik, Quebec

• Cape Smith Belt is host to prolific high-grade

polymetallic nickel deposits and includes two

operating mines: Raglan and Nunavik Nickel

• Located ~60 km from Glencore’s Raglan

Mine

➢ Raglan is a first quartile cash cost nickel

operation

➢ One of the highest ore grades among

significant global nickel deposits (P&P

reserves: 11.3Mt at 2.79% Ni, 0.76% Cu

and 2.83 g/t PGE)

West Raglan ProjectOverview of Key Targets

Identified outcropping sulphide mineralization over +35 km of strike with limited testing at many zones

• Magnetic signatures, lithogeochemistry, and geology are the same at West Raglan’s Frontier zone as Glencore’s Raglan Mine

• The Southern part of property has magnetic and till anomalies suggestive of Nunavik Mine (South Trend) style mineralization

➢ Nunavik Mine had a 2010 M&I resource estimate of 21.9M tonnes at 0.93% Ni, 1.15% Cu, 0.05% Co and 2.86 g/t PGE
